Output 240621aa45ae7e94d923bbaa29c1a06489b91da868bdba497c6e84b2fd572398:20

value
517714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b87c6f70e30b13ec6d6f3808fb12b115c0f8036 OP_EQUAL
address
34Capguo77XH6tCyUeGtgCwUGRSqYK5Xur
transaction
240621aa45ae7e94d923bbaa29c1a06489b91da868bdba497c6e84b2fd572398
spent
true